Illinois HB2424 amends the Property Tax Code to adjust the maximum homestead exemption reductions for different counties and taxable years.
HB2424 amends the Property Tax Code to set the maximum homestead exemption reductions based on county population and taxable years. For taxable years 2023 and beyond, the maximum reduction is $10,000 in counties with 3,000,000 or more inhabitants, $8,000 in counties contiguous to such counties, and $6,000 in all other counties. The bill also specifies conditions for granting leasehold exemptions and defines "homestead property" to include leased-to-purchase or lease-option contracts.
